Abstract

The paper studies the dynamic of a brake of crank press. At present, the dynamic research of brake of the crank presses, with account of interaction with other links, is a priority. The crank press contains movable parts and links, the mass of which is from one hundred kilograms to several tons. These parts and links are cyclically stopped when braking with a crank press almost instantaneously, and they are subject to high dynamic loads. To simulate and analyze the movement of crank press with brake, a software package: SimulationX is used. SimulationX is a software package for modeling and analyzing the dynamics and kinematics of cars, industrial equipment, electric, pneumatic and hydraulic drives, hybrid engines, etc. As a result of dynamic calculation, important dynamic parameters of the crank press brake and working ram are determined. It is shown that dynamic loads sharply increase almost in all links of the crank press when the brake is switched on.
